Address

D6pPfRiCEwfD1BPMTtqfcpmEz1cHjisjonCopy

Total Received

9805.03360625 DOGE

Total Sent

0 DOGE

№ Transactions

299

Final Balance

9805.03360625 DOGE

Transactions
Filter